NATIONAL RURAL HOUSING COALITION
EIN 52-0952436 · Research Institutes & Public Policy Analysis (L05)
What they do
to Carry On A Continuing Program of Research, Education, Information and Organization, Focused On Low-income Housing and Directed Toward Those Persons of Low and Moderate Incomes Who Want to Improve Their Housing Conditions;

Ask these three easy questions
- Who did you help? Ask for a recent story or report that shows real results.
- What will my money do? Ask exactly what your gift will pay for.
- Is this really the charity? Give only through its official website or confirmed phone number.
Bottom line: Do not decide from a name, mission statement, or tax status alone. Look at where the money went, then ask what changed, who was helped, and what your gift will do. YouCanGiveBack does not endorse or grade organizations.
